        public T FindFirst <T>(CriterionSet criterionSet) where T : class
        {
            var persistentObjects = new List <T>(FindAll <T>(criterionSet));

            var persistentObject = (persistentObjects.Count > 0) ? persistentObjects[0] : null;

            return(persistentObject);
        }

        public IEnumerable <T> FindAll <T>(CriterionSet criterionSet)
        {
            using (ISession session = GetSession())
            {
                var persistentObjects = new List <T>();

                var criteria = session.CreateCriteria(typeof(T));
                criteria.SetCacheable(true);

                foreach (var criterion in criterionSet.GetCriteria())
                {
                    ICriterion expression;

                    if (criterion.Operator == ComparisonOperator.GreaterThan)
                    {
                        expression = Restrictions.Gt(criterion.Attribute, criterion.Value);
                    }
                    else if (criterion.Operator == ComparisonOperator.LessThan)
                    {
                        expression = Restrictions.Lt(criterion.Attribute, criterion.Value);
                    }
                    else if (criterion.Operator == ComparisonOperator.NotEqual)
                    {
                        if (criterion.Value == null)
                        {
                            expression = Restrictions.IsNotNull(criterion.Attribute);
                        }
                        else
                        {
                            expression = Restrictions.Not(Restrictions.Eq(criterion.Attribute, criterion.Value));
                        }
                    }
                    else
                    {
                        if (criterion.Value == null)
                        {
                            expression = Restrictions.IsNull(criterion.Attribute);
                        }
                        else
                        {
                            expression = Restrictions.Eq(criterion.Attribute, criterion.Value);
                        }
                    }

                    criteria.Add(expression);
                }

                if (criterionSet.OrderBy != null)
                {
                    if (criterionSet.SortOrder == SortOrder.Descending)
                    {
                        criteria.AddOrder(Order.Desc(criterionSet.OrderBy));
                    }
                    else
                    {
                        criteria.AddOrder(Order.Asc(criterionSet.OrderBy));
                    }
                }

                var list = criteria.List();
                foreach (T entity in list)
                {
                    persistentObjects.Add(entity);
                }

                return(persistentObjects);
            }
        }
